Not Bringing Dependants along for a PEO appointment

Post by delver » Wed Nov 09, 2011 10:09 am

I have read at various postings on this forum that people who had SET(O) PEO appointments with dependants have gone alone and it was acceptable.

I have a PEO appointment coming up next month and the instructions clearly state in the "Appointment Checklist"
Bring all the dependants registered in your application with you to this appointment.
With that in mind, is there any official guidance anywhere about not requiring to take dependants along or is it just tried and tested tradition.

Post by zahid.ali.anwar » Wed Nov 09, 2011 10:16 pm

Since you don't need to register their biometric information at ILR, that's why you don't need them at appointment.

If, however, you are applying for an extension application that requires your biometric data then you need to bring/take all of your dependents.
